Harrison County Utility Authority Salary

As of May 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Harrison County Utility Authority in the United States is $82,812.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$40. Salaries at Harrison County Utility Authority typically range from $72,951 to $93,393 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Gulfport?

Understanding the cost of living near Gulfport is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Harrison County Utility Authority.
Gulfport's Cost of Living Index is approximately 82.5 (17.5% less expensive than US average; 4.1% less than MS average). Gulf Coast city, casinos, affordable housing. CTA (Coast). When planning your budget based on a salary from Harrison County Utility Authority,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$850 - $1,300+ A significant portion of Harrison County Utility Authority sal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$260 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(CT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$370 - $550 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$630+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$650+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,110 - $3,390+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
